ABSTRACT
Under the weaker conditions on the drift and diffusion terms, this paper focuses on the global decentralised output-feedback control for a class of large-scale stochastic high-order upper-triangular nonlinear systems. By introducing an appropriate coordinate transformation, the original system is transformed into an equivalent one with tunable gain. After that, by reasonably combing the homogeneous domination approach with stochastic nonlinear systems stability criterion, and skillfully choosing the low gain scale, the decentralised output-feedback controller is constructed for each subsystem to ensure that the closed-loop system is globally asymptotically stable in probability. The simulation example is given to demonstrate the effectiveness of the proposed design scheme.

Liang Liu
Liang Liu was born in Zaozhuang, Shandong Province, China, in 1985. He received his B.S. degree from Weifang University in 2007, and his M.S. and Ph.D. degree from Qufu Normal University in 2010 and 2013, respectively. Since 2013, he joined the College of Engineering, Bohai University, where he is currently an associate professor. He is also a postdoctoral fellow in Nanjing University of Science and Technology from July 2015. His research interests include decentralised adaptive control of complex systems, time-delay systems and stochastic nonlinear control.

Yifan Zhang
Yifan Zhang was born in Heilongjiang Province, China, on 12 August 1989. She received her B.S. degree in Mathematics and Applied Mathematics from Bohai University, Jinzhou, China, in 2014. She is pursuing her M.S. degree in Applied Mathematics in Bohai University, Jinzhou, China. Her research interests include decentralised control and stochastic nonlinear control.
